Distributed Artificial Intelligence for the Operating Room – DAIOR
Highly complex surgical procedures can be performed more safely and precisely with the help of artificial intelligence (AI). However, in order to significantly improve patient care, AI algorithms first need to be extensively trained using suitable data. By applying federated learning methods, AI algorithms can be trained using data from different locations, even across national borders, while the data remains at the respective sites and data protection is ensured.
With these clinically impactful use cases and the planned AI ecosystem, DAIOR aims to establish the operating room of the future within the hospital of the future — a digitally connected environment capable of continuously receiving, transmitting, and processing knowledge.
The project contributes to the development of practical distributed AI methods and the establishment of a sustainable scientific and technological cooperation structure. It also promotes German-French collaboration in the field of AI in healthcare.

Funding agency
The project is funded by the German Federal Ministry of Education and Research (BMBF) and the French Ministry of Higher Education and Research (MESR). The funding initiative is part of the implementation of the German Federal Government’s AI Strategy and the High-Tech Strategy 2025. In Germany, the bilateral funding initiative is administered by the DLR Project Management Agency, while in France it is administered by the French National Research Agency (ANR).
